Dont work for the insurance companys, work for the customers, How about just dealing with the customers, dont even talk to the insurance adjustor, write your estimate, have the customer sign the repair authorization and bill them, let them work out the details with their insurance, we are not attorneys and theirfor can not legally "adjust" or settle a calim for them, now of course you will ahve ot explain this to your customers. But you would get paid, and the insurance company will easilly pay them before you, and if they dont how long do you think that person will stay with that company?

Check this out http://www.autobodyonline.com/discussion/

I copied this from a thread there "And who cares what other shops charge for. I get paid for things routinely that other shops don't because I'm not negotiating and "working with" the insurance company. I'm charging the vehicle owner for it because it's necessary and they are owed that for a proper job. IF their insurance company doesn't want to reimburse them for all necessary operations that is NOT YOUR PROBLEM.

Get real people and get out of from under all this control. The insurance company has you all brainwashed.

What you should be doing is involving your customers and letting THEM Decide what they want. "Mr. Smith, do you want these part labels removed? I'll have to charge for it but I want you to have the job you desire."

STOP DEALING/NEGOTIATING/BOWING to the insuarnce companies and start doing all of the above to the real customer and watch your bottom line grow, your customers be much happier and your industry turn around.

This isn't a game, this is business, stop playing games and start running businesses."
